Les Halles Boulangerie & Patisserie Delights Epcot Guests – Opening its doors in the France Pavilion each morning at 9 a.m., ahead of the 11 a.m. opening of World Showcase, Les Halles Boulangerie & Patisserie offers delightful French sweets and savories for Epcot guests throughout the day. Menu items include espressos, sweets, soups, sandwiches, salads and authentic French dishes such as quiche, Croque Monsieur ...

A Glimpse at the New California Grill – Re-opening in summer 2013, California Grill will receive a makeover designed by Puccini Group in San Francisco. The spacious restaurant atop Disney’s Contemporary Resort will feature a wall of wines at the entrance and spectacular views from every table. Magic Kingdom Guests Dine in Splendor at Be Our Guest Restaurant – With an elegant setting right out of Disney's "Beauty and the Beast," Be Our Guest Restaurant magically takes Magic Kingdom diners into the French countryside for French-inspired cuisine. Featuring a large music box centerpiece nearly 7 feet tall with Belle and the Beast slowly twirling atop, the Rose Gallery at Be Our Guest Restaurant is adorned with rose accents, paintings and tapestries, . The stylish restaurant serves quick-service lunch and table-service dinner in New Fantasyland at Walt Disney World Resort in Lake Buena Vista, Fla.
